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72999634518 9025600 30869080 4471101278 5222240898
966567 34
966567 34
300594002 89 333191598
All about undefined
Interested in learning more?
966567 34
300594002 89 333191598
See more
37530 77733551405
382 935 834
See more
8206 2439394 5618874119
7057167578 12 162473
See more